#2377d9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2377d9 is composed of 13.7% red, 46.7%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.9% cyan, 45.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 212.3 degrees, a saturation of 72.2% and a lightness of 49.4%. #2377d9 color hex could be obtained by blending #46eeff with #0000b3.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#2377d9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02080e is the darkest color, while #fcf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2377d9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7e82 is the less saturated color, while #0675f6 is the most saturated one.
